The recovery time for both of these processes depends on the age of the dog. Young females can take 2-3 days to resume regular activity, and males take 1-2. Many owners do not know, but over-the-counter medications routinely used in humans (such as aspirin, paracetamol, or ibuprofen) can be dangerous and even fatal to their animals. It also leads to a little bit of dehydration which is why keeping the temperature up too high (for instance, keeping your pet too close to a fireplace or heat source) is also ill-advised, as this may increase the necessity for water intake at a moment when the pet is still too drowsy to be interested in any food or drink. If your dog is walking funny or has a stilted gait or severe tummy upset, these symptoms could suggest there was an issue with the surgery and that it's time to call your vet. Keep your dog in a room or a in a crate of adequate size when you are not able to supervise it. Most animals, with a round of anesthesia that lasts approximately 15 to 20 minutes, will be ready to go home and act quite normally six to seven hours after, Lund tells The Dodo. Never medicate your pet, especially with human pain meds, for they are very toxic to both cats and dogs (but cats especially have a larger deficiency in the enzymes necessary to metabolize our human pain meds).
